Transaction 3ba14d62e9e6e53bc71feca3d318405da6445f5e63fff00afd28c63e0d644fc7
1 Input
1 Output
-
3ba14d62e9e6e53bc71feca3d318405da6445f5e63fff00afd28c63e0d644fc7:0
- value
- 104686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bba366443917b5e1613b44e50c3387cc9c4d31a9 OP_EQUAL
- address
- 3JoA2cP8XmUN7eZdhBZrw4ZfZ1kPNakhzV